Concerns Rise Among Small Businesses Over Potential Trump Tariffs

Small businesses across the United States are increasingly anxious about the potential impact of new tariffs proposed under the Trump administration. As trade policies shift, many entrepreneurs are left wondering how these changes will affect their operations and bottom lines. The uncertainty surrounding tariffs has created a climate of apprehension, particularly among those who rely heavily on imported goods for their products.

Many small business owners fear that increased tariffs could lead to higher costs for materials, which may ultimately be passed on to consumers. This could reduce demand and stifle growth in an already challenging economic environment. Furthermore, small businesses often lack the financial cushion to absorb these additional expenses, making them particularly vulnerable to the repercussions of trade policy changes.

As discussions around tariffs continue, small business owners are calling for clarity and support from policymakers to navigate these turbulent waters. They emphasize the need for a balanced approach that considers the unique challenges faced by small enterprises in the evolving global market.
